Product Description:


Infinitely intricate, our Kaleidoscope collection is made from hundreds of tiny pieces of bone, carved by the skilled hands of artisans in India and pressed into black resin to create swirling geometric patterns. Its single drawer and cupboard are painted black inside and finished with monochromatic striped handles.

Know the Difference Between bone inlay furniture and Mother of Pearl inlay furniture.

Bone inlay has a natural, earthy look with a matte finish, while Mother of Pearl inlay looks shiny and elegant with its iridescent glow. Both materials can be used for various patterns and can be applied to any furniture or homeware items in our online store.
